Personal data William (William III) d'Aubigny 

Source 1
  • First name William III.
  • He was born in the year 1161.
  • Title: lord, de Belvoir
  • Profession: Governor of Rochester castle..
  • He died on May 1, 1236 in Offington, Leicestershire, Royaume-Uni, he was 75 years old.
  • A child of William d'Aubigny and Maud de Clare

Notes about William (William III) d'Aubigny

He was one of the 25 sureties or guarantors of the Magna Carta.
